V8_MA61 wrote on Thu, 28 April 2005 18:50 | MX13 CORONA HAD A W40 4 SPEED.
|
.......which can easily substituted with a w50 5 speed.
their bellhousings are interchangable and the tailshaft is the same.
so get a manual bellhousing from a mx13 - mx2X (maybe more) and whack it on a w50 celica 5 speed
